Factors Affecting Cost

Vapor barrier installation is a common step in building or renovating basements and crawl spaces in Northville, MI. Proper installation helps control moisture and prevent mold growth, contributing to healthier indoor environments.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can assist in planning and budgeting for this project.

  • Materials: Common vapor barriers include polyethylene sheets, typically 6 mil or thicker, suitable for residential applications in Northville's climate.
  • Size and Scope: Installation covers crawl spaces or basement floors, with coverage depending on the area size and specific project requirements.
  • Labor Complexity: The process involves preparing the surface, laying the barrier, and sealing edges, which can vary in complexity based on space accessibility and existing conditions.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Northville may require permits for moisture barrier installations, especially in new construction or major renovations.
  • Additional Considerations: Optional extras include vapor barrier tape, sealing of vents, and insulation integration, which can influence overall project scope and cost.
